What is digital workplace engineering?

Digital Workplace Engineering involves designing, implementing, and maintaining the digital tools and technologies that enable employees to work efficiently from anywhere. This field focuses on integrating software, hardware, and cloud solutions to support collaboration, communication, and productivity in modern organizations. Professionals in this role ensure that systems like intranets, collaboration platforms, and virtual desktops are secure, reliable, and user-friendly. They also work to continuously improve the digital employee experience by adopting new technologies and best practices.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a digital workplace engineer?

To thrive as a Digital Workplace Engineer, you need expertise in IT infrastructure, cloud services, end-user computing, and a relevant degree or certifications such as Microsoft 365 or Azure. Familiarity with tools like Microsoft Endpoint Manager, Active Directory, collaboration platforms (e.g., Teams, Slack), and automation systems is typical. Strong problem-solving, communication, and project management skills help drive user adoption and ensure seamless digital experiences. These abilities are essential for optimizing digital workflows, ensuring security, and enhancing productivity in modern hybrid work environments.

What are some common challenges faced by digital workplace engineers, and how can they be addressed?

Digital Workplace Engineers often face challenges such as integrating new collaboration tools with legacy systems, ensuring seamless user experiences across diverse devices, and maintaining security in a rapidly evolving digital environment. Addressing these requires strong problem-solving skills, continuous learning about emerging technologies, and effective communication with both IT and end-users. Regular cross-functional meetings and proactive monitoring can help identify potential issues early and ensure solutions align with business needs.

What does a digital workplace engineer do?

A digital workplace engineer designs, implements, and manages digital tools and systems that enable employees to collaborate and work efficiently. They often work with cloud platforms, collaboration software, and security protocols, requiring skills in IT infrastructure, troubleshooting, and user support. Their role ensures seamless digital experiences across an organization’s technology environment.

Expectations and Skills:
As a Data Center Lead, you will be spending more than 50% of the time working alongside Data Center Technicians in supporting installs, troubleshooting, and maintaining servers. The remaining time will be spent on daily onsite/area management of staff and other non-technical duties. You will play a crucial role in identifying and escalating opportunities within the client's infrastructure for efficiency and effectiveness improvements. Expansion of extensive knowledge and experience working with computers and related knowledge is expected along with added supervisory responsibilities. Prior leadership experience is desired.
